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Repair: The specific repair needed, such as glass replacement, frame repair, or sealing, will impact the cost.
- Window Size: Larger windows typically require more materials and labor, increasing the overall expense.
- Material Quality: Higher-quality materials, such as double-pane glass or specialized coatings, will generally cost more.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Longview, WA, can vary, affecting the total cost of the repair.
- Urgency: Emergency repairs or quick turnarounds may come at a premium price.
- Accessibility: Windows that are difficult to reach may require additional equipment or labor, increasing the cost.
- Additional Features: Features like tinting, energy-efficient glass, or custom designs can add to the overall expense.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(USD) |
---|---|
Basic Glass Replacement | $100 - $150 |
Double-Pane Glass Replacement | $200 - $300 |
Frame Repair | $150 - $250 |
Full Window Replacement | $400 - $600 |
Sealing and Insulation | $75 - $125 |
Emergency Repair Services | $200 - $400 |
